The lake air and slower pace make that distinction feel less like a compromise than a relief.<\/p>\n<h2>1874 changed what a summer gathering could be<\/h2>\n<p style=\"font-size:17px;line-height:1.8;margin:0 0 18px;\">The Chautauqua Institution began in <strong>1874<\/strong> as an outdoor summer school for Sunday school teachers. It grew into a model for public education and culture, mixing learning with music, theater, faith, literature, and civic debate. Outside that window, the setting may still be calm, but the institution\u2019s defining rhythm changes.<\/p>\n<h2>The movement reached millions, then the original remained<\/h2>\n<p style=\"font-size:17px;line-height:1.8;margin:0 0 18px;\">Independent Chautauquas appeared across North America, and touring tent versions later carried the concept to rural communities. At their peak, those circuit events drew <strong>more than 45 million people<\/strong>. That scale explains why the word still carries cultural weight in the United States.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size:17px;line-height:1.8;margin:0 0 18px;\">Yet the touring circuits eventually ran their course. The original Chautauqua Institution endured, along with a smaller number of continuing assemblies. And that survival gives a visit a useful tension: you are in a living seasonal community, while standing at the source of a much larger story.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size:17px;line-height:1.8;margin:0 0 18px;\">You can feel the difference between an institution built for repeat visitors and a one-stop heritage attraction. Chautauqua has a summer program around lectures, public discussions, classical music, opera, theater, dance, visual arts, workshops, religious programs, and educational offerings for different generations.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size:17px;line-height:1.8;margin:0 0 18px;\">It is cultural travel with structure.
